About The Position

The Residential Services Director will be responsible for the day-to-day operations of OCYFS's Emergency Shelter and Qualified Residential Treatment Program. This role is for someone ready to make a real difference in their community.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ree in a related field plus one year's experience in managing a child care facility, OR a High School education and five year's experience in managing a child care facility.
  • Supervisory experience required.
  • Pass a drug screen and maintain a current TB card.
  • Must have a current Arkansas Driver's license and insurable under OCC's commercial vehicle insurance policy.
  • Must receive child maltreatment clearance through the Arkansas Child Maltreatment Central Registry.
  • Must receive adult maltreatment clearance through Arkansas Protective Services-Adult Maltreatment Central Registry.
  • Must receive Arkansas State Police criminal background clearance as mandated by Arkansas Department of Human Services, Minimum Licensing Standards for Child Welfare Agencies.

Responsibilities

  • Supervises, schedules and evaluates direct care staff.
  • Ensures that emergency shelter care is performed according to OCYFS's mission, policies and procedures, funding, performance indicators and OCYFS's vision and beliefs.
  • Provides on-going training for direct care staff and identifies unmet training needs.
  • Monitors Emergency shelter and QRTP record documentation.
  • Reviews direct care staff client file & log documentation.
  • Coordinates and schedules on and off campus activities for OCC residents.
  • Ensure that monthly/quarterly drills are assigned and performed.
  • Prepares/maintains readiness for all State, local, or other licensure inspections.
  • Ensure safety, organization and cleanliness of building in coordination with OCYFS maintenance staff and Facilities Director.
  • Attends Management Meetings as scheduled.
  • Participates in OCYFS's quality improvement and serves on assigned committees.
  • Reviews performance quality improvement reports to identify areas of needed improvement and participates in developing and implementation solutions to improve quality of service.
  • Assist in development of yearly plan that supports OCYFS long term strategic goals.
  • Participates in OCYFS's annual budget planning.
